Slovakia - Re-Import of Hollow Drill Bars and Rods of Alloy and Non-Alloy Steel
Since 2014, Slovakia Re-Import of Hollow Drill Bars and Rods of Alloy and Non-Alloy Steel increased 21.5% year on year. At $9,749.86 in 2019, the country was ranked number 5 comparing other countries in Re-Import of Hollow Drill Bars and Rods of Alloy and Non-Alloy Steel. Slovakia is overtaken by Thailand, which was number 4 at $27,291.72 and is followed by United Kingdom at $7,765.62. South Africa lead the ranking with $906,886.94 in 2019, that is a fall of 22.2% compared to 2018. Australia witnessed the best average annual growth at +89.5% per year, while South Africa was the worst growing country at -8.9% per year.
